How to make payments for your online degree
Just as our online programmes offer convenience and flexibility in study, we ensure the same when it comes time to make a payment. Find out more information about how to pay your student fees below.

Payment methods
We accept several ways of paying your student fees, including:
- EasyTransfer
- Convera Bank Transfer
- Flywire
- Direct bank transfer
- Online payment via credit or debit card
Unfortunately, we don’t accept cash payments, in any currency.

International student deposits
We require all international applicants (except those from the United States, Norway, or the EU) of our postgraduate programmes to pay an initial refundable deposit before making a full deposit payment. The amount of deposit paid is located in your offer letter and deducted from tuition fees at the point of enrolment. To ensure a full refund for this initial deposit, we require students to pay by Flywire or Convera. All other payment methods, including direct bank transfers, are considered non-refundable.
